POSITION: NURSING/ LAB INSTRUCTOR
Full-time tenure track position
CLASSIFICATION: Faculty
RESPONSIBILITIES:
Including but not limited to:
• Develop and teach clinical simulation scenarios utilizing SimMan and other high fidelity equipment.
• Evaluate nursing skills utilizing high and low fidelity equipment.
• Maintain open lab hours for student skill practice and assist students as needed.
• Video tape student skill demonstrations as required.
• Supervise student use of computers and all other equipment in the laboratory.
• Maintain current policy and procedure manuals for each facility hosting students for clinicals.
• Maintain an inventory and check-out system for all equipment and audio-visual materials.
• Support the nursing program during college events.
• Teaching responsibilities will consist of a combination of nursing lab, clinical and lecture hours. Course offerings in Nursing, Health Care and Health and Human Performance may be taught to achieve an equivalent of 15 contact hours. (See reverse side for course listing.).
• Work with local healthcare providers, advisory committees, regional and state-wide vocational organizations.
• General involvement as a faculty member in participatory college governance, advisement of students, assessment of student learning, etc. (As per the Faculty Role Description).
• May assist with writing curriculum.
MINIMUM POSITION QUALIFICATIONS:
• Master’s Degree in Nursing
• Maternal Child or Psychiatric Nursing specialty
• Two years of successful teaching experience at the community college level preferred
• Experienced with SimMan and other simulation equipment preferred
• Current Illinois R.N. License
• CPR certified by the American Heart Association
• Demonstrated commitment to professional growth
• Commitment to the mission of the community college and to teaching and motivating community college students in ways appropriate to their diverse backgrounds and learning styles
